Job Overview

Consultants in CRA’s Energy practice have researched, published, taught, and consulted on energy matters for a wide range of clients, including electric and gas utilities, investors, power asset owners and developers, power agencies, large industrial firms, and clean energy technology leaders. Our work in the energy industry has guided the energy transitions of major firms, established legal precedents in economics, and set new standards in market design and oversight.  We have advised on developing the structure of national and regional competitive markets, reorganized multi-billion-dollar companies, testified in hundred-million-dollar damages litigation, and played a key role in most North American utility mergers and acquisitions that have taken place over the last decade.

CRA is seeking a Transmission Strategy and Planning expert to join our team.

As a Principal, you will conduct research and use software to organize, analyze, and deliver data-driven insights, and you will always have your project team as a resource. Your responsibilities may include (but are not limited to): 

  • Be a thought leader in market analysis and transmission planning space;
  • Provide technical expertise to project teams for engagements with both a principal focus on transmission planning matters including technical and commercial;
  • Lead and manage engagements for our utility clients seeking advanced and novel rate design approaches. Serve as a key expert in public stakeholder forums and senior/executive management meetings;
  • Maintain strong client relationships and take a multi-channel approach to developing new relationships;
  • Identify new opportunities for our clients and create or define products and services that will provide value for clients across markets and transmission space;
  • Oversee the entirety of the client engagement process with little-to-no oversight, from sourcing to final project delivery;
  • Deliver presentations and reports to concisely, comprehensively, and accurately share findings with clients on complex matters.

Qualifications

  • Bachelors degree in Electrical Engineering, Engineering Economics, Engineering Management, and/or related fields. Master's degree preferred. 
  • 10+ years of professional experience in transmission market analysis.
  • 5+ years of professional experience directly managing or leading the work of others.
  • Experience supporting public stakeholder meetings and company executive meetings.
  • Extensive experience managing project teams and clients.
  • Demonstrated success in selling client engagements and maintaining these relationships over time.
  • Experience developing, working with, and interpreting output from complex market and grid planning models.
  • Excellent presentation skills and writing ability. 
  • Strong problem-solving abilities and resourcefulness.
  • Working well in a team environment, and willingness to provide mentorship and supervision to junior staff members.

Work Location Flexibility

CRA creates a work environment that enables our colleagues to benefit from being together in the office to best deliver on our promise of career growth, mentorship and inclusivity. At the same time, we recognize that individuals realize a range of benefits when working from home periodically. We currently ask that individuals spend 3 to 4 days a week on average working in the office (which may include traveling to another CRA office or to a client's location), with specific days determined in coordination with your practice or team. At certain times of the year (e.g. holiday periods), additional remote work options are offered to those whose work commitments permit it, although our offices remain open for those who choose or need to be there.
